API Security Testing: Essential Procedures for shielding Your Electronic Assets

In today’s digital landscape, APIs (Application Programming Interfaces) Perform a crucial job in enabling interaction amongst distinct computer software applications. However, While using the raising reliance on APIs arrives the heightened danger of stability vulnerabilities. This is when API safety testing results in being necessary. In the following paragraphs, We'll take a look at the value of API safety testing and supply vital techniques to protect your electronic property.

Comprehending API Stability Screening
API security tests is the entire process of evaluating the safety of APIs to discover vulnerabilities that might be exploited by malicious actors. This sort of screening is critical for the reason that APIs typically serve as gateways to delicate info and functionalities. By implementing strong API security testing, corporations can safeguard their electronic assets and manage user trust.

Why API Security Tests is Vital
The increase of cyber threats has manufactured API safety tests a necessity. APIs are often specific due to their accessibility and the precious info they handle. A prosperous attack on an API may lead to info breaches, unauthorized access, and important monetary losses. Hence, companies must prioritize API safety tests to mitigate these threats and ensure the integrity of their programs.

Key Tactics for Successful API Stability Screening
one. Carry out Frequent Safety Assessments
One of the best strategies for API protection testing is to carry out regular safety assessments. This will involve assessing the API’s architecture, authentication mechanisms, and details handling procedures. By carrying out these assessments usually, organizations can discover vulnerabilities prior to they can be exploited.

two. Employ Authentication and Authorization Controls
Strong authentication and authorization controls are important components of API protection testing. Be certain that your APIs demand strong authentication techniques, for instance OAuth or API keys, to verify consumer identities. On top of that, apply purpose-based accessibility controls to limit access to delicate details and functionalities according to consumer roles.

three. Use Automated Screening Applications
Automated screening tools can substantially enrich the efficiency of API safety tests. These tools can swiftly establish common vulnerabilities, including SQL injection and cross-web page scripting (XSS). By integrating automated screening into your progress pipeline, you can make certain that stability is a steady concentration throughout the API lifecycle.

4. Keep an eye on API Targeted visitors
Monitoring API site visitors is an additional necessary strategy for successful API protection tests. By analyzing site view visitors styles, corporations can detect uncommon pursuits which will indicate a safety breach. Applying logging and checking answers can help you answer speedily to opportunity threats and maintain the security of your APIs.

5. Educate Your Growth Workforce
A well-informed advancement staff is important for successful API security screening. Give teaching on protected coding practices and the importance of API safety. By fostering a lifestyle of protection recognition, you could empower your team to construct more secure APIs from the bottom up.

six. Conduct Penetration Tests
Penetration tests is a proactive approach to API safety screening. By simulating true-earth assaults, corporations can identify vulnerabilities that may not be apparent by means of typical assessments. Participating 3rd-occasion stability industry experts for penetration testing can provide an unbiased evaluation of one's API’s stability posture.

Conclusion
In conclusion, API security testing is An important exercise for shielding your electronic belongings within an significantly interconnected world. By implementing the methods outlined in this article, companies can substantially minimize the chance of API vulnerabilities and boost their All round safety posture. Standard assessments, sturdy authentication controls, automatic screening equipment, visitors monitoring, workforce training, and penetration testing are all critical components of a comprehensive API security screening method. Prioritizing these procedures is not going to only safeguard your APIs but in addition Construct have confidence in along with your consumers, making certain the extended-phrase achievement of one's digital initiatives. Remember, in the realm of cybersecurity, proactive steps are normally more practical than reactive kinds

Leave a Reply

Your email address will not be published. Required fields are marked *